Fuel Filter Replacement

The fuel filter should be replaced whenever the fuel pressure drops below the specified value (270-320 kPa, 2.8-3.3 kgf/cm2 , 40-47 psi) after making sure that the fuel pump and the fuel pressure regulator are OK.

  1. Remove the fuel tank unit (see Fuel Pump/Fuel Gauge Sending Unit Replacement  ).
  2. Remove the fuel filter set (A).

  3. Install the part in the reverse order of removal with a new base gasket (D) and new O-rings (E), then check these items:
    • When connecting the wire harness, make sure the connection is secure and the terminal (B) is firmly locked into place.
    • When installing the fuel gauge sending unit (C), make sure the connection is secure and the connector is firmly locked into place. Be careful not to bend or twist it excessively.
